Wallabies End Tour on a High Note.

Three tries from Scott Staniforth helped Australia to a 49-35 win over the Barbarians in the final game of their European Tour

The World champions ended their disappointing tour of Europe with a 49-35 win over the Barbarians at the Millennium Stadium.

South African right wing Breyton Paulse also weighed in with a hatrick of tries for the Ba Bas who in the end were outscored by seven converted tries to five as Australia put the disappointment of Test defeats by England and France behind them.
